Overview

We are seeking a Mid‑Level Scientist to join our team in Atlanta, GA. Your role involves evaluating environmental impacts of transportation projects, conducting field investigations, performing GIS mapping, and preparing technical reports that coordinate with state and federal agencies.

Responsibilities
  • Develop project task schedules and document required ecological permits, prioritized by baseline schedules.
  • Provide status updates at project meetings and maintain tracking databases.
  • Assess impacts of transportation projects on natural resources and identify opportunities to minimize potential effects.
  • Coordinate with design professionals and the overall project team to accurately depict natural resources on construction plans.
  • Lead field investigations, including wetland and stream delineations with functional assessments per applicable methodologies.
  • Perform GPS field mapping, post‑processing, and distribute GPS‑mapped resources in multiple formats.
  • Collect, analyze, and interpret quantitative and qualitative data on projects of varying complexity within Georgia and the southeast.
  • Map and describe on‑site habitats, identifying those suitable to support protected species.
  • Prepare documentation and technical reports detailing findings of ecological surveys and coordinate with state and federal agencies.
Qualifications
  • B.A./B.S. or M.S. in a scientific discipline; minimum three years of experience since Bachelor’s degree or two years with Master’s degree.
  • Experience reviewing and interpreting construction plans.
  • Knowledge of NEPA documentation and/or Phase 1 Environmental Site Assessments preferred.
  • Proficiency with MS Office, ArcGIS/Arc Pro, and GPS.
  • Experience working with GDOT and linear projects with federal funding is a plus.
  • Strong botanical identification skills within southeastern ecoregions.
  • Completed GDOT pre‑qualification training in Ecology.
  • Excellent technical writing and verbal communication skills.
  • Strong organizational, task and time management, deductive reasoning, and analytical skills.
  • Professional attitude and attention to detail while working alone and in a team environment.
